Description
We are looking for a versatile RF Electronics Engineer to contribute to the development of advanced electronic products. The role involves sub-system requirements definition, designing hardware with associated analysis and ensuring rigorous validation, with a strong emphasis on metrology, PCB design, and mixed-signal electronics. The engineer will work flexibly on various product developments based on project needs, including topics related to multi-physics interactions.
Key Responsibilities:
Design and validate low-noise electronics for next-generation products,
including circuits where high-frequency constraints and parasitic effects are critical.
Perform electronic analyses, including for example Part Stress and Worst-Case , as well as RF-related evaluations (impedance, coupling, EMC/EMI considerations).
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ams (mechanics, software, production) to ensure seamless integration.
Design and implement test systems to validate electronic products, including defining test procedures and measurement methods.
Operate and program advanced measurement tools (e.g., spectrum analyzers, FFT analyzers, frequency counters).
Document technical processes, including specifications, test plans, and qualification reports.
Support product industrialization and establish acceptance criteria in collaboration with production teams.
Required Skills and Profile:
Degree in Electronics Engineering or equivalent, with experience in both product and test system development.
Strong knowledge of metrology and precision measurement techniques.
Proficiency in Altium Designer for PCB layout and circuit design, including good practice for high-frequency routing and EMI/EMC robustness
Experience in mixed-signal electronics, including low noise systems, oscillators and active analog circuits
Familiarity with circuital and electromagnetic simulation tools (e.g. ADS, CST)
Autonomous, methodical, and capable of managing priorities across multiple projects.
Team-oriented with excellent problem-solving and analytical abilities.
Strong communication skills (both written and verbal) in English; knowledge of French is an asset
